Understanding Foodborne Illness: Why Symptoms Can Be Delayed
Foodborne illness, commonly referred to as food poisoning, does not always cause immediate physical symptoms after ingestion of contaminated food. According to the Centers for Disease Control and Prevention (CDC), the time between consuming a contaminated product and the onset of illness—known as the incubation period—can range from a few hours to several days or even weeks, depending on the specific pathogen involved.
Why Does Symptom Onset Vary?
The delay in symptoms occurs because different bacteria, viruses, and parasites require varying amounts of time to multiply within the human digestive tract or produce toxins that trigger a reaction. The Mayo Clinic notes that while some pathogens like Staphylococcus aureus can produce toxins that cause illness within one to six hours, others, such as Listeria monocytogenes, may take several weeks to manifest symptoms.

This variability often makes it difficult for individuals to identify the specific meal or food item responsible for their illness. Because the contaminated food may have been consumed days prior, patients often overlook potential sources, complicating epidemiological investigations by health departments.
Common Pathogens and Their Incubation Periods
Different microorganisms have distinct characteristics regarding how they affect the body. The following table highlights common foodborne pathogens and their typical symptom timelines:
| Pathogen | Typical Onset of Symptoms |
|---|---|
| Staphylococcus aureus | 1–6 hours |
| Salmonella | 6 hours – 6 days |
| E. coli (STEC) | 3–4 days |
| Listeria | 1–4 weeks |
Source: Data aggregated from the CDC and FDA.
How to Identify Potential Food Poisoning
While the timing of symptoms is inconsistent, the clinical presentation of foodborne illness is generally uniform. According to the U.S. Food and Drug Administration (FDA), common symptoms include nausea, vomiting, abdominal cramps, and diarrhea. Fever and dehydration may also occur in more severe cases.
It is important to differentiate between a localized digestive upset and a systemic infection. If symptoms persist, are accompanied by a high fever (over 102°F), or involve signs of severe dehydration, medical intervention is necessary. Dehydration is a significant risk, particularly in young children, the elderly, and individuals with compromised immune systems.
Preventing Future Exposure
Because symptoms are delayed, prevention remains the most effective strategy for managing foodborne illness. The USDA Food Safety and Inspection Service recommends four core pillars for home food safety:
- Clean: Wash hands and surfaces frequently to prevent cross-contamination.
- Separate: Keep raw meat, poultry, and seafood away from ready-to-eat foods.
- Cook: Use a food thermometer to ensure that foods reach the proper internal temperature to kill bacteria.
- Chill: Refrigerate perishable foods promptly at 40°F or below to slow the growth of harmful bacteria.
By adhering to these standardized safety protocols, consumers can significantly reduce the risk of contracting foodborne illnesses, even when the potential for delayed symptom onset makes it difficult to pinpoint the exact moment of exposure.
